Measurement of the reaction 7-fp-+p-f-n'-f-n' was performed in the mediumenergy region up to 1,160 MeV by detecting the recoil proton and one of the decaygamma-rays from the neutral pions, The cross section is very small below 650 MeVand is consistent with the prediction given by the static theory. The cross sectionbeyond 650 MeV, however, increases steeply with photon energy and has a valueof about 20 gb at 900 MeV and about 40 7zb at 1,000 MeV.
